We've found 1 listings you may like
TOKAT, Turkey
Dubai, United Arab Emirates
United States of America
United States of America
United States of America
United States of America
United States of America
United States of America
Los Angeles, United States of America
Los Angeles, United States of America
Los Angeles, United States of America
Los Angeles, United States of America
Los Angeles, United States of America
Los Angeles, United States of America
Netherlands
British Columbia, Canada
British Columbia, Canada
British Columbia, Canada
British Columbia, Canada
Ohio, United States of America
Oyten, Germany
United States of America
Veghel, Netherlands
Veldhoven, Netherlands
Veghel, Netherlands
Veghel, Netherlands
United States of America
United States of America
United States of America
© 2025 PlantAndEquipment.com